InterGlobe Aviation Limited (INDIGO) has announced the closure of its trading window for dealing in the company's shares. This closure is in accordance with the SEBI (Prohibition of Insider Trading) Regulations, 2015, and the Company's Code of Conduct for Designated Persons.
The trading window will be closed effective from Thursday, January 01, 2026. It will remain shut until 48 hours after the declaration of the unaudited financial results for the quarter and nine months ending December 31, 2025.
The company will intimate the date of the Board Meeting, which will be held to declare these financial results, in due course.
